Generator的應(yīng)用場景,最典型的是代表異步流程和狀態(tài)機(jī)
程序員通過提升技術(shù)功底、深入理解業(yè)務(wù)、強(qiáng)化溝通與學(xué)習(xí)管理能力,可提高個(gè)人不可替代性,為公司創(chuàng)造更大價(jià)值。
件開發(fā)過程中,減少Bug的策略包括需求討論、自測、白盒與黑盒測試、代碼檢查、邊界處理、單元測試和經(jīng)驗(yàn)積累。
程序員是否需成為業(yè)務(wù)專家?技術(shù)實(shí)現(xiàn)與業(yè)務(wù)理解的平衡。
泛型程序設(shè)計(jì)(generic programming)是程序設(shè)計(jì)語言的一種風(fēng)格或范式 泛型允許我們在強(qiáng)類型程序設(shè)計(jì)語言中編寫代碼時(shí)使用一些以后才指定的類型,在實(shí)例化時(shí)作為參數(shù)指明這些類型 在typescript中,定義函數(shù),接口或者類的時(shí)候,不預(yù)先定義好具體的類型,而在使用的時(shí)候在指定類型的一種特性。
9月TIOBE編程語言排行榜顯示C語言跌至歷史最低,排名第4,而Python和Java表現(xiàn)強(qiáng)勁。
Python是一門功能強(qiáng)大且易于上手的編程語言,擁有豐富的標(biāo)準(zhǔn)庫和活躍的第三方模塊社區(qū)。Python模塊是為了實(shí)現(xiàn)特定功能而編寫的一組函數(shù)和工具集合,能夠輕松擴(kuò)展Python的功能,提高開發(fā)效率。本文將向您介紹Python模塊的安裝方法,讓您快速掌握如何利用Python模塊來增強(qiáng)您的編程體驗(yàn)。